About Bertil Hult


B ertil Hult is a Swedish self-made billionaire and the founder of EF Education First, one of the world's largest private education and language training companies. Hult's entrepreneurial journey was shaped by his personal struggles with dyslexia, which made traditional schooling difficult for him. However, he discovered that he could learn English much more easily through immersion while spending time in the United Kingdom.

This personal experience gave him the idea for his business. In 1965, he founded EF in the basement of his university dormitory, initially organizing summer language trips for Swedish high school students to England. He grew the company with a relentless focus on expansion and marketing, branching out into language schools, cultural exchanges, and academic degree programs. Today, EF Education First is a global giant with operations in dozens of countries. He has since stepped down from the CEO role, passing leadership to his sons, but he remains the owner and visionary behind the massive education empire he built.

Early Life and Background


Born in Stockholm, Sweden, in 1941, Bertil Hult is a Swedish billionaire and the founder of EF Education First, the global language school and educational travel company. His entrepreneurial journey began with a profound personal challenge: he struggled severely with dyslexia as a high school student in Sweden, finding traditional classroom learning frustrating and ineffective.

His defining realization came during a summer job in London, where he found himself effortlessly picking up English just by living the language in an immersive environment, rather than studying it academically. This moment convinced him that cultural immersion was the superior way to learn. He dropped out of Lund University after one year and, at the age of 23 in 1965, he founded EF Education First in the basement of his university dormitory, driven by the belief that a true education helps people explore the world and understand themselves.

Career Journey of Bertil Hult


Bertil Hult founded EF Education First as a language study and travel abroad organization, initially focusing on sending Swedish high school students to England to learn English. His business model was radical: build educational programs around his core belief in immersion learning, effectively transforming language education from a purely academic pursuit into a life-changing travel experience.

Under his leadership as CEO (until 2002) and Chairman (until 2008), EF grew into a massive, multi-billion dollar corporation with a presence in over 50 countries, employing over 40,000 people. EF’s influence became structural, pioneering online language schools and international exchange experiences. The company is also affiliated with the Hult International Business School (named in his honor) and runs the Hult Prize ($1 million award for social enterprise). Hult secured his fortune by maintaining wholly private ownership of EF within his family, ensuring the long-term, mission-driven continuity of the business model.

Philanthropy and Social Impact


Bertil Hult’s philanthropy is deeply personal, driven by his experiences with dyslexia and a commitment to combating drug abuse. He is a founding member and trustee of the Mentor Foundation, a non-governmental organization focused on supporting research and initiatives in drug prevention globally.

His giving also targets dyslexia education, sponsoring the Bertil Hult Prize for Swedish schools that excel in supporting dyslexic students. The Hult Prize competition, which awards $1 million for social enterprise, has funded numerous startups globally. His dedication to immersion learning has structurally broken down barriers of language, culture, and geography for millions of students worldwide.
